[DRE-commits] [vagrant-libvirt] 138/163: Allow isolated networks
Antonio Terceiro
terceiro at moszumanska.debian.org
Sun Apr 24 13:57:16 UTC 2016
This is an automated email from the git hooks/post-receive script.
terceiro pushed a commit to annotated tag 0.0.26
in repository vagrant-libvirt.
commit b7a9abfc16ad555c2fbdb5a386ad92ff2e83b27d
Author: John Beredimas <mperedim at gmail.com>
Date: Mon Mar 9 11:01:19 2015 -0400
Allow isolated networks
---
lib/vagrant-libvirt/templates/private_network.xml.erb | 10 +++++++---
lib/vagrant-libvirt/version.rb | 2 +-
vagrant-libvirt.gemspec | 2 +-
3 files changed, 9 insertions(+), 5 deletions(-)
diff --git a/lib/vagrant-libvirt/templates/private_network.xml.erb b/lib/vagrant-libvirt/templates/private_network.xml.erb
index 65ac5f9..e3c8f9a 100644
--- a/lib/vagrant-libvirt/templates/private_network.xml.erb
+++ b/lib/vagrant-libvirt/templates/private_network.xml.erb
@@ -2,7 +2,7 @@
<name><%= @network_name %></name>
<bridge name="<%= @network_bridge_name %>" />
- <% if @network_forward_mode != 'none' %>
+ <% if (@network_forward_mode != 'none' && @network_forward_mode != 'isolated') %>
<% if @network_forward_device %>
<forward mode="<%= @network_forward_mode %>" dev="<%= @network_forward_device %>" />
<% else %>
@@ -10,12 +10,16 @@
<% end %>
<% end %>
- <ip address="<%= @network_address %>" netmask="<%= @network_netmask %>">
+ <% if @network_forward_mode != 'isolated' %>
+ <ip address="<%= @network_address %>" netmask="<%= @network_netmask %>">
+ <% end %>
<% if @network_dhcp_enabled %>
<dhcp>
<range start="<%= @network_range_start %>" end="<%= @network_range_stop %>" />
</dhcp>
<% end %>
- </ip>
+ <% if @network_forward_mode != 'isolated' %>
+ </ip>
+ <% end %>
</network>
diff --git a/lib/vagrant-libvirt/version.rb b/lib/vagrant-libvirt/version.rb
index b4a637d..26cc284 100644
--- a/lib/vagrant-libvirt/version.rb
+++ b/lib/vagrant-libvirt/version.rb
@@ -1,5 +1,5 @@
module VagrantPlugins
module ProviderLibvirt
- VERSION = '0.0.25'
+ VERSION = '0.0.26'
end
end
diff --git a/vagrant-libvirt.gemspec b/vagrant-libvirt.gemspec
index 26a4adb..4cc64a9 100644
--- a/vagrant-libvirt.gemspec
+++ b/vagrant-libvirt.gemspec
@@ -7,7 +7,7 @@ Gem::Specification.new do |gem|
gem.license = 'MIT'
gem.description = %q{libvirt provider for Vagrant.}
gem.summary = %q{libvirt provider for Vagrant.}
- gem.homepage = 'https://github.com/pradels/vagrant-libvirt'
+ gem.homepage = 'https://github.com/mperedim/vagrant-libvirt'
gem.files = `git ls-files`.split($\)
gem.executables = gem.files.grep(%r{^bin/}).map{ |f| File.basename(f) }
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-ruby-extras/vagrant-libvirt.git
More information about the Pkg-ruby-extras-commits
mailing list